Coach: Not good enough
YOU’D THINK A championship-winning coach would be happy? Think again.
Springer Memorial’s basketball coach Francis Thompson isn’t pleased at the way the girls’ game is treated. He slammed the National Sports Council [NSC] for supposedly not organising the girls’ tournament with the same efficiency as the boys’ equivalent.
Thompson made the criticism mere moments after his team won a second successive title via Thursday’s 45-43 overtime thriller over hosts The St Michael School.
“I think girls’ basketball needs a bigger push from the Sports Council level as Barbados has sent more girls on scholarship [in basketball] than boys. Actually, I would dare say off the top of my head it may be double or nearly triple the numbers,” said Thompson.
